In fact does anyone have a picture reference of Man o' war with the green stripes, since I can only find it with a white chevron type pattern on the nose.
 
You'll need to identify which one is which, as all of his P51s were named 'Man o' War'. I think I might have some pics as per the kit decals, but nothing showing the OD stripes on the upper surfaces, as far as I know. The white nose markings were applied, I believe, just at the end, or soon after, the war in Europe. Before that, the 4th FG red nose band was seen, eventually extending rearwards. Good pic. At a guess, as the lower fuselage AEAF stripes are still in place, I'd say it was pre-October 1944. After about this time, remaining stripes were normally removed.
